**Runbook: Log sampling — Skylark ingest service**

Skylark emits ~40k log lines/min at baseline. Default sampling is 1:50 on INFO, full capture on WARN and above. If disk alerts fire on the Hollowpine cluster, drop INFO sampling to 1:200 via the config flag — no restart needed. Never disable sampling entirely during incidents; it floods the Tally pipeline. Revert within 24h. Current sampling config and override history live on the page below.

runbook for hahap-baduf: https://jira.qorvelsys.internal/projects/projects/pages/projects/c0cb

Changed defaults in Splitfork, our assignment service. Bucketing now uses sticky hashing per account instead of per session, and the holdout slice grew from 2% to 5%. Callers relying on session-level reassignment must opt in explicitly. Review the diff against the new baseline; the updated default configuration is listed below.

config for tagep-kajof:
[casir]
port = 6379
region = south-1
host = casir.paliqdyn.example
team = tamax
timeout_ms = 250
retries = 2

Migration Step 4: Re-point the string extractor

Before running the Lexiplume extraction script against the new cluster, confirm that the previous run completed by checking the extraction_runs table for a terminal status. The script walks every source bundle, pulls untranslated keys, and writes them to the catalog schema, so an interrupted run leaves orphaned rows that must be purged first. Once verified, update the script's config so it targets the migrated catalog database using the following connection string:

replica DSN, kajep-yahag: mssql://praok_svc:iF@db-8d68.plorvaio.local:5432/eliion

Hey plugin folks — quick handover on ChunkLens, our diff viewer for large files. The streaming tokenizer now caps memory at 256MB, so your plugins should hook into the new onChunkReady callback instead of reading the whole buffer. Docs for the plugin API are in the repo wiki. Deprecation of the old sync hooks lands next quarter. Questions about the migration should go to the new owner:

named custodian: Brivan Eliath Quenox Frador